Now this is a RUMOR take it with a grain of salt and all that. This applies both to the Redo of Imagination as well to Epcot Forever but it matters more for imagination and that’s why I’m posting it here. As everyone knows in Epcot Forever children and NOT Dreamfinder or Figment sing “One Little Spark” in the show. According to Jim Hill and Len on the latest edition of the Disney Dish this was a very hard decision and basically as Len said it the reason why the children were chosen is “Don’t make promises we cannot keep”. Apparently Imagination is in Phase 2 of Epcot’s re-do and they aren’t sure what they are going to do. Including how big of a role Figment will have as well as if Dreamfinder will even appear. I know this has been said by some insiders over the course of time, but I found these little more tidbits to be interesting.
